MyHealthTeams and EMD Serono, through their MS-LINK initiative, launch the Treatment and Adherence Resource Center within MyMSTeam, the social network for people living with multiple sclerosis (MS).

The Resource Center is designed to help diagnosed patients and their families understand the importance of starting treatment and provides actionable tips for staying on disease-modifying therapies (DMTs), a media release from MyHealthTeams explains.
